Scholarships

The Spade and Trowel Club believes in the importance of education.  Starting in 2022, the club awarded a $1000 Scholarship through the Kennett Education Foundation to a Kennett High School graduating senior interested in Horticulture and/or Environmental Studies. Qualified candidates are screened and chosen through the guidance counselors at the school.   This scholarship is being awarded annually, with the amount reviewed each year.  For 2023, $1500 was given to our recipient.  The club, along with individual member donations, awarded $2,500 to our recipient in 2024 and $2000 in 2025.  

Students who are eligible for Spade and Trowel Club scholarship may also be eligible for $1,000 scholarships through the Garden Club Federation of Pennsylvania (GCFP) of which Spade and Trowel Club is a member.  The deadline for GCFP scholarship applications is in February.  The scholarship application is located in the Forms Library of the GCFP website.
